What Makes a Pickleball Shoe Ideal for Men?
The ideal pickleball shoe for men combines specific features to enhance performance and comfort during play.
- Lightweight design
- Cushioning and support
- Traction and grip
- Breathable materials
- Lateral stability
- Durability
- Style and aesthetics
Transitioning into the detailed exploration, understanding each essential feature will help in selecting the best shoe for playing pickleball effectively.
-
Lightweight Design: A lightweight design is crucial for pickleball shoes. It allows players to move quickly and easily. Many brands, like ASICS and Nike, focus on minimizing weight while maintaining structural integrity. A lighter shoe reduces fatigue and enhances game performance.
-
Cushioning and Support: Proper cushioning and support protect the feet and joints during play. Shoes with cushioned midsoles absorb shock and provide necessary comfort. For example, shoes with EVA foam or gel cushioning effectively reduce impact. Studies have shown that optimal cushioning can improve performance and reduce injury risk.
-
Traction and Grip: Traction is vital for sudden movements and direction changes in pickleball. Shoes designed with rubber outsoles often feature patterns that enhance grip on court surfaces. The right traction minimizes slippage and maximizes stability, supporting quick lateral movements.
-
Breathable Materials: Breathability keeps feet cool and dry. Shoes made with mesh uppers allow air circulation, reducing moisture. Enhanced breathability can lead to increased comfort during extended play, as noted in a 2019 study from the Journal of Sports Sciences.
-
Lateral Stability: Lateral stability is essential due to the quick side-to-side movements in pickleball. Shoes with reinforced sides or wider bases provide better support and reduce the chance of ankle sprains. For example, the New Balance 996 offers excellent lateral support features that improve stability.
-
Durability: Durability ensures that shoes withstand the wear and tear of frequent games. High-quality materials and reinforced stitching contribute to longer-lasting footwear. Players should consider shoes specifically designed for hard court surfaces to increase longevity.
-
Style and Aesthetics: Style and aesthetics can be significant factors for many players. A visually appealing shoe can boost confidence on the court. Brands often launch stylish designs, catering to personal preferences and focusing on functionality while maintaining a trendy look.

How Does Traction Impact Performance in Men’s Pickleball Shoes?
Traction significantly impacts performance in men’s pickleball shoes. Traction refers to the grip a shoe provides on the playing surface. High traction allows players to move quickly and change direction swiftly. This capability enhances agility and stability during play. Reliable grip prevents slipping, reducing the risk of falls or injuries. Additionally, good traction helps in maintaining balance, which is crucial for executing shots effectively. Players who can trust their footwear to provide solid grip can focus more on their game. Therefore, the traction of pickleball shoes plays a vital role in overall performance and safety on the court.
Why is Cushioning Essential for Men’s Pickleball Shoes?
Cushioning is essential for men’s pickleball shoes to provide support and reduce the impact on joints during play. Proper cushioning enhances comfort and can prevent injuries by absorbing shock.
According to the American Podiatric Medical Association, cushioning in athletic shoes helps to minimize stress on the feet and lower limbs, ultimately improving performance and reducing the risk of injuries.
The need for cushioning arises from the nature of pickleball, which involves quick lateral movements, sudden stops, and frequent changes in direction. These activities can put significant stress on the feet and joints. Cushioning helps distribute this pressure evenly, protecting vulnerable areas such as the heels and arches.
Cushioning refers to the materials used in the shoe that absorb shock and provide comfort. Common cushioning materials include ethylene vinyl acetate (EVA) and polyurethane. EVA is lightweight and promotes flexibility, while polyurethane is more durable and provides greater support over time.
The mechanisms involved in cushioning include shock absorption and energy return. Shock absorption occurs when the cushioning material compresses under impact, dispersing the energy throughout the shoe. Energy return happens when the cushioning material rebounds, helping to propel the athlete forward during movement.
Specific conditions that contribute to the need for cushioning include the player’s weight and playing style. Heavier players may require more cushioning to handle the increased impact. Additionally, players who are prone to injuries like plantar fasciitis may benefit from extra support in the shoe’s arch and heel areas. For instance, players who engage in fast-paced rallies with extended periods of hard court play will experience higher impact forces, increasing the necessity for effective cushioning.
